Warm-up10 min

Mat Movements + Week 7 Review

Setup: Staggered lines, arm's-width apart, one direction. Pairs form for the review half.

How it works: Lengths, twice each: shrimps, bridges, technical stand-up, seated back-scoots. Then the new one that IS tonight — hip lifts: on your back, swing both legs up and lift the hips high like a shoulder-stand, scissor the legs once at the top, come down with control. Ten each, twice. Review week 7 in pairs, one minute each way: seatbelt and hooks built from seated, partner rolls slowly, back player follows.

What to say

  • Hip lifts: the hips go to the ceiling, not the feet over the head.
  • Scissor at the top slow — that shape is the armbar, ninety minutes early.
  • Review the seatbelt layers out loud: chest, belt, hooks, head.

Easier

Half-lengths; hip lifts with knees bent and no scissor.

Harder

Hip lifts holding two seconds at the top; review at quarter resistance.
